David Martin wrote:Will an iPod play .wma files?


Just checking...

OK... here's the answer...

You load any file onto your iPod through iTunes (installed on your computer).

When you drag and drop a *.wma file into iTunes, it automatically converts it into the AAC format (one of the formats playable on the iPod).
